A group of former Republican members of Congress criticized the Trump administration for the "outrageous" criminal charges against a Democratic lawmaker accused of assaulting and impeding law enforcement at an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) facility in New Jersey.
Rep. LaMonica McIver of New Jersey faces federal charges for allegedly assaulting agents at an ICE facility, which she dismisses as political intimidation.
Prosecuting McIver is a rare federal criminal case against a sitting member of Congress for allegations other than fraud or corruption.
